WebIf you are named as an executor in someone’s will, you have a lot of duties and responsibilities placed upon you. It will fall to you to gather in and value the assets of the estate, pay off any debts and liabilities, calculate and pay any inheritance tax (IHT) that is due – and distribute the estate in accordance with the will.
